Output 56f2aa7e3c86b783f895d119ab923b65af301e2a68cb2f0867f2e511270f7c64:3

value
122893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3e4409f9ea8b674b5eb518273122fe82a72f8a OP_EQUAL
address
3BqDX91mmgfhHeyEh6fqpp7SLYRhBxgCzi
transaction
56f2aa7e3c86b783f895d119ab923b65af301e2a68cb2f0867f2e511270f7c64
spent
true